As of September 2026, Sheridan Beach Club Condo in Hollywood, FL has 1 home for sale. Over the 12 months ending 2026-09-12, 5 recorded sales closed at a median of $280,000, $250 per square foot, a median 36 days on market, sellers accepting 94% of original asking. Homes listed or recently sold were built 2003–2006; 6 of 6 report an HOA (median $541/mo); 4 of the 4 geocoded homes sit in a FEMA special flood hazard zone (median elevation 6 ft). At the median price and Broward County's FY2025-26 rate of 19.84 mills, annual property tax runs about $5,560 ($4,730 with the full homestead exemption).

Oceanfront inventory, episodic turnover
Sheridan Beach Club Condo sits on Hollywood's beachfront, and that location anchors every valuation conversation. The median price of $278,500 reflects older construction, variable unit condition, and the trade-offs buyers accept for direct ocean access at a price point well below new coastal construction. The $242/sf median tells you this is not luxury finish—it is location-first value, where buyers prioritize water access over granite and stainless upgrades.
Six closings in six months means thin inventory and episodic availability. You will not find five comparable units to choose from on any given week; when the right unit appears, decision windows are narrow. The 53-day median DOM reflects the selectivity of the buyer pool—financing contingencies, association financials review, and condition assessments all extend timelines in older buildings. Sellers who price to condition and disclose honestly tend to close; those who overprice for location alone sit.
The building itself offers no identified amenities in current MLS listings, which means the value proposition is the address and the Atlantic. Buyers here are self-directed—they want the beach, accept the building's age and maintenance profile, and understand that special assessments and reserve adequacy are part of the condo ownership equation. This is not a turn-key product; it is an entry point to oceanfront living for buyers who know what they are trading.
